## Canary Gating — Driftgate Environments

Quick refresher for the weekly sync: Driftgate runs our canary gating in staging-mirror and prod, and the rules differ on purpose. Staging-mirror auto-promotes after the error-budget check; prod requires both the latency gate and a manual ack from whoever's on release duty. If a canary sits un-promoted for more than the bake window, it auto-rolls back — that's expected, not a bug. The gates evaluate against the thresholds in config, which currently reads as follows.

deployment values, fahap-hahaf:
[casdor]
port = 9200
region = south-2
host = casdor.qirvanworks.corp
timeout_ms = 3000
retries = 4

Ticket: Staging env misconfigured for Siftgate bloom filter

The bloom layer in front of the Pellet KV store is rejecting all lookups in staging because the env file was copied from the dev template without credentials. False-positive tuning values are fine; only the auth line is missing. To unblock the weekly demo, the Pellet admission secret must be set on the following line.

env line for yaguf-fajop: LEDGER_TOKEN13=fb08984397349

Subject: DR drill — nightly search reindex (Lanternquill)

Team,

Next Thursday we'll run the disaster-recovery drill for the Lanternquill nightly reindex job. We will simulate loss of the index coordinator and restore from the cold snapshot. Security reviewers are invited to observe credential handling. The snapshot decryption step is manual and requires the recovery passphrase noted below.

vault phrase of fahog-yajof = istael-zorwyn

Ticket: DeployParrot posts stale status to plugin channels. When a plugin subscribes mid-deploy, the bot replays the last completed deploy instead of the in-flight one, so external dashboards show "success" during an active rollout. Plugin authors should treat replayed messages as advisory until this is fixed. Reproduction requires two subscribers; the affected build is identified by the token below.

session token of bawep-yadup = htk21_528abd376e3c5a4ec24a1